§ 65-27-105 — Authority to lay pipes

Tennessee·Title 65

To enable the corporation to establish its works, it is empowered to:

(1)Lay down pipes through the streets, lanes, and alleys of the town, city, or village in such manner as to produce the least possible inconvenience to the town, city, or village, or to its inhabitants, or to travelers; and (2) Take up pavements and sidewalks; provided, that it shall repair the same with the least possible delay.

Legislative History

Acts 1877, ch. 104, § 1; Shan., § 2492; Code 1932, § 4066; T.C.A. (orig. ed.), § 65-2705.
